Why Scottsdale Draws So Many Relocation Buyers

Scottsdale continues to attract buyers for a few clear reasons. The city offers sunshine, outdoor recreation, strong neighborhood identity, and convenient access to the greater Phoenix metro.

A lot of relocating buyers also like that Scottsdale has distinct pockets instead of one cookie-cutter feel. That means you can narrow your search by lifestyle, not just price.

What makes the city appealing

  • Established neighborhoods with mature landscaping
  • Easy access to dining, golf, parks, and shopping
  • A wide range of home styles, from ranch homes to luxury properties
  • Strong interest from both families and professionals

Best Scottsdale Areas to Start Your Search

One of the smartest moves is to begin with neighborhood fit. If you do that first, the home search gets much easier.

Park Scottsdale 85250

Park Scottsdale is a popular option for buyers who want a central location and a true neighborhood feel. It is especially appealing if you want established streets, practical access to daily errands, and a classic Scottsdale setting.

This area often works well for buyers who want convenience without giving up residential character. If that sounds like you, the Best Neighborhoods in Scottsdale for Families article is worth reading too.

Old Town Scottsdale

Old Town is ideal if you want walkability, nightlife, restaurants, and a more energetic atmosphere. It is a strong fit for buyers who value convenience and an active lifestyle.

McCormick Ranch and nearby central areas

If greenbelts, trails, and a more relaxed feel matter to you, central Scottsdale communities like McCormick Ranch often make sense. These neighborhoods give many relocation buyers a balanced mix of comfort and accessibility.

North Scottsdale

North Scottsdale tends to appeal to buyers looking for newer homes, larger lots, and a more spacious residential environment. It is often a strong choice for people who want a bit more room and a quieter setting.

FAQ

Is Scottsdale a good place to relocate to?

Yes, Scottsdale is a strong relocation choice for buyers who want sunshine, amenities, and a wide range of neighborhoods. It works especially well for people who want a blend of lifestyle and long-term resale potential.

What is Park Scottsdale like for new residents?

Park Scottsdale offers a central location, established streets, and a classic Scottsdale feel. It is a practical option for buyers who want convenience and a neighborhood that feels settled.

Which Scottsdale area is best for families?

That depends on your priorities. Families often look at Park Scottsdale, McCormick Ranch, and other central neighborhoods because they offer a balance of location, access, and livability.

Should I rent first before buying in Scottsdale?

Some buyers do rent first, especially if they are new to the area and want time to compare neighborhoods. If you already know your priorities, buying sooner can help you settle into the right area faster.

How can I compare Scottsdale neighborhoods more easily?

Start by comparing price, commute, home style, and neighborhood feel. Then look at active listings and recent sales so you can see what is realistic in each area.
